This first novel in Darlene Bolseny's Duanor series is a rip-roaring, swashbuckling fantasy adventure, a blend of The Three Musketeers, The Adventures of Don Juan, The Lord of the Rings, The Thief of Baghdad, and the 87th Precinct mysteries.

Welcome to the shadow-haunted, twin-mooned world of Duanor.
Meet Morticai ...
He’s a rogue and a ladies’ man, a gambler and a thief, a duelist and a troublemaker and ... a lawman!
Surviving on the mean streets of Watchaven wasn’t easy for an unwanted corryn orphan, but Morticai managed to escape the criminal underworld by joining the Northmarch, the kingdom’s elite peacekeeping force.
When Morticai discovers that a nest of Droken - the same bloodthirsty devotees of an outlawed god who murdered his parents - have infiltrated his city, he will risk his commission and his life to bring them to justice.
It’s not the first time that Morticai has found himself in over his head, but it may turn out to be the last.
